The opening of SHE'LL BE RIGHT, MATE? An Indigenous History in Australian Cartoons was held on Sunday 6 July 2014 at Burrinja Gallery.
The Hon. Heidi Victoria MP, Minister for the Arts, was there to open the show.

SHE'LL BE RIGHT, MATE? is curated by Jim Bridges, President, Australian Cartoon Museum and Burrinja's JD Mittmann. The exhibition chronicles issues of Indigenous affairs in Australian society, sports and politics in the last 30 year. The cartoons are drawn from the archive of the Australian Cartoon Museum. Nicholson, Jeff, Spooner, Knight, Leunig, OZ and many more are featured.
